SylviaTWIGGIt is with great sadness that the family of Miss Sylvia Twigg announces her passing on Saturday 12th November 2022 aged 92 years. Sylvia was a retired chemistry teacher who passed away peacefully at home. She will be lovingly remembered by all her family and friends. Private funeral, family flowers only. Further enquiries to Eddie Tucker Funeralcare Telephone 01792 280101.
